ChildFund International is recognized as a leader in child protection and psychosocial interventions with children in conflict and natural disasters. ChildFund International recognizes the importance of grassroots development by engaging parents, children, youth and local volunteers in program decisions affecting their communities.
ChildFund International works in 31 countries, assisting more than 15.2 million children and families regardless of race, creed or gender. ChildFund International helps deprived, excluded and vulnerable children have the capacity to become young adults, parents and leaders who bring lasting and positive change in their communities. ChildFund International promotes societies whose individuals and institutions participate in valuing, protecting and advancing the worth and rights of children.
